Create a Profit / Loss Statement for more than 30 columns

There are instances when users would want to run a comparative Income Statement for a span of multiple Periods / Months. Currently, the system will only allow users to add up to 30 columns in the Income Statement due to performance issues. The ability to expand the column limit is currently filed as Enhancement# 195728. The alternate solution is to create a Saved Search. The bandwidth in running Saved Searches over Reports is longer and should not time out.

To illustrate, assume that a user wants to create an Income Statement with the Amount column for the last 36 Periods / Months, i.e. 3 years. To create the Saved Search:

1. Navigate to Transactions>Management>Saved Searches>New
2. Select Transaction
3. On the Criteria tab add Posting is Yes, Account Type is Cost of Goods Sold / Income / Expense / Other Expense / Other Income, and Date is within relative from 36 months ago to 0 months ago
4. On the Results tab add Account with Summary Type = Group and the following Formula(Numeric) with Summary Type = Sum

5. Hit Save and Run
This Saved Search works (i.e. matches the Income Statement) when Home>Set Preferences>Reporting/Search>Report by Period is Never. In other words, the Saved Search is a comparative Profit / Loss or Income Statement based on transaction date and not Posting Period. A much more complicated Saved Search can be designed if users need to use Period primarily focused on converting the Period string to a numeric value (i.e. Jan 2013 = 1, Feb 2013 = 2, etc.). This Saved Seach can then be expanded to other accounts with the same business need.
